Just a little west of the intersection is a terrific Japanese restaurant, Toh Zan Nagasaki Grill. Just to the east is a terrific little sub shop with very unique atmosphere, Cheba Hut. There's a Mexican restaurant, Top Shelf, that is to be avoided at all costs.

There is a lot of stuff there, two chinese places, Best Hong Kong and a szechuan place. BHK is hit and miss in my opinion.
Dragonfly is a vietnamese place that is good. Great short ribs and calamari.
There are also two other places there I have not tried and can't remember (they both looked good - maybe korean and thai? ). Plus there is sakatini and an oreganos.

Used to work close by- IIRC that shopping plaza has Asiana Market, Dragonfly's Mesa location, a boba tea place, Best Hong Kong Dining, and a Japanese fusion martini bar called Blue Wasabi I think? Best Hong Kong used to be good, haven't been there in a while but I've heard it's gone downhill lately, Dragonfly is pretty good, boba place is pretty standard, and I haven't tried Blue Wasabi or whatever it's called.
Or it might be Mekong Plaza that you are thinking of, at Dobson & Main, just a few miles north of Southern.

There is one called Best of Hong Kong on the northwest corner of those streets that, of my opinion, has been on steady decline the past few years. They still have pretty decent duck and pork but the other dishes are not what they used to be.
In the same corner is a Korean place called Hodori I was not blown away by either.
